Thursday, October 19, 2017

Pgpromise migrations

What would be your recommended approach to long-term schema mutations alongside the use of pg - promise ? A common approach is, . We have written our own migration workflow on top of pg - promise because all the alternatives . PostgreSQL and pg - promise and being able to browse the database . Migrations and schema dumps. The resulting promise resolves into a connected database instance. You can connect Massive to your database with a pg - promise configuration object or . Sequelize, an ORM and tool box ( migrations and such). Used pgpromise on a couple of projects and like it. Knex migration functions should “always return a promise ” according to its documentation.


Concurrent non-blocking queries (synchronized with promises ). This issue is caused by using different version of pg - promise. QueryFile class from different version of pg - promise are incompatible. Here we compare between knex, massive, pg - promise , sequelize and squel.


This is the next part of the open-source review of pg - promise. Create new migration file r. Starting with version 3. Config still contains the read-only pg - promise configuration. NOTE: Check out pg - promise -demo for a more comprehensive example of setting. It provides you comprehensive query API, migrations and even basic . ORM for Postgres, MySQL, MariaDB, SQLite and Microsoft SQL Server. It features solid transaction support, relations, . I am tring to write a migration script using node- pg -migrate module, but not able to succeed in.


Postgresql database migration management tool for node. Promises interface for PostgreSQL. Now you can start building tables with migrations and seeding data! Understand how to create database migrations and seed files using knex. Install knex globally and in your project, and pg (postgres) in your project from npm:.


Connection pool for node-postgres. TypeScript, supports migrations , Active Recor has an excellent query builder. For example, the provided code sample uses Knex.


To do so you will have typeorm generate the migration. Does anyone have any thoughts on what migration tool to use along with pg - promise to manage schema changes? Unhandled promise rejections are deprecated. In the future, promise rejections that are not handled will terminate the Node. I created a migration.


I had unfortunately ran the column creating migration at the same time as the connection. Multi-row insert with pg - promise.

No comments:

Post a Comment

Note: Only a member of this blog may post a comment.

Popular Posts